Wal-Mart's (WMT 0.46%) first-quarter earnings were in line with expectations, but same-store sales fell 1.4%. In this segment from the Motley Fool Money radio show, our analysts discuss what the future holds for the world's largest retailer, and if its stock can continue to beat the market.
